Spire Inc. (SR) presents a profile of a stable utility with notable growth attributes, though an absence of strong near-term catalysts tempers its outlook. As a natural gas utility, over 90% of its profits are derived from regulated operations, providing significant earnings predictability and contributing to its track record of a 2.5% average earnings surprise. The company is projected to deliver 9% year-over-year earnings growth for the current fiscal year, a robust figure for its sector, which is reflected in its strong 'B' Growth Style Score and 'A' VGM Score from Zacks. However, this is counterbalanced by a neutral Zacks #3 (Hold) rank. This rank likely stems from a lack of broad upward earnings estimate revisions, as the fiscal 2025 consensus estimate has remained flat at $4.50 per share despite a single analyst's upward revision in the last 60 days. This suggests that while the underlying fundamentals and growth story are solid, widespread analyst conviction for outperformance has not yet materialized.
